Population size is dynamic, increasing with birth rates and immigration, and decreasing with death rates and emigration. In ideal conditions with unlimited resources, populations can increase exponentially, which plots as a J-shaped growth rate curve of population size against time. This type of curve is characteristic of newly-introduced invasive species, or populations that have suffered catastrophic declines and are rebounding.

Deformation occurs in axial and transverse directions when an axial load is applied to a slender bar. This deformation impacts the cubic element within the bar, transforming it into either a rectangular parallelepiped or a rhombus, contingent on its orientation. This transformation process induces shearing strain. Axial loading elicits both shearing and normal strains. Applying an axial load instigates equal normal and shearing stresses on elements oriented at a 45° angle to the load axis.

Firm Size and Employment during the Pandemic.

Ken-Hou Lin1, Carolina Aragão1, Guillermo Dominguez1

  • 1The University of Texas, Austin, TX, USA.

Socius : Sociological Research for a Dynamic World
|June 30, 2021
PubMed
Summary

Workers in small businesses faced higher unemployment risk during the COVID-19 pandemic. This study reveals firm size impacts job security, potentially accelerating market concentration trends.

Area of Science:

  • Economics
  • Labor Economics
  • Business Studies

Background:

  • Previous research indicates a wage premium associated with firm size, though this has diminished recently.
  • The initial phase of the coronavirus disease 2019 (COVID-19) pandemic presented unprecedented economic challenges.

Purpose of the Study:

  • To investigate the relationship between firm size and unemployment risk during the early stages of the COVID-19 pandemic in the United States.
  • To determine if firm size influences job security in the face of a major economic shock.

Main Methods:

  • Analysis of unemployment data based on firm size during the initial COVID-19 outbreak.
  • Utilizing both yearly and state-month variations to assess unemployment disparities.
  • Controlling for worker sorting and industrial context to isolate the effect of firm size.

Main Results:

  • Workers in small enterprises experienced significantly higher excess unemployment compared to those in larger firms.
  • The firm size advantage in job security was most evident in sectors with high remote work capability.
  • This advantage reversed in industries most severely impacted by the pandemic's direct effects.

Conclusions:

  • Firm size is demonstrably linked to differential job security, with larger firms offering greater protection.
  • The pandemic appears to have accelerated pre-existing trends toward product and labor market concentration.
  • Initial policy interventions were insufficient in safeguarding employees of small and medium-sized businesses.
